Understanding Hyaluronic Acid Technology
Hyaluronic acid is a naturally occurring substance in the human body, known for its ability to retain moisture and support tissue health. In orthopedic applications, HA is used to supplement synovial fluid, which lubricates joints and reduces friction. Anika’s proprietary technology enhances these properties, offering advanced treatments for joint pain and tissue regeneration.

Regenerative Solutions for Tissue Repair
Anika’s regenerative solutions focus on repairing and restoring damaged tissues. Products like Integrity™ and Hyalofast® are engineered to support the body’s natural healing processes. For instance, Integrity™ is used in rotator cuff and tendon repair augmentation, providing structural support and enhancing biological integration. Clinical outcomes have shown improved postoperative imaging and patient mobility, with many individuals returning to their desired activities without restrictions.
Another product, NanoFx®, addresses bone marrow stimulation, promoting the growth of new tissue. These innovations highlight the potential of HA in not just managing symptoms but also facilitating long-term tissue recovery.
Osteoarthritis Pain Management
For patients suffering from osteoarthritis, Anika offers a range of non-opioid treatments. Cingal®, a combination HA and steroid injection, provides immediate pain relief that lasts up to six months. This dual-action approach reduces inflammation and improves joint function, offering a viable alternative to traditional pain management methods.
Other products like Monovisc® and Orthovisc® are single- and multi-injection HA viscosupplements, respectively. These treatments are designed to restore joint lubrication and alleviate discomfort, enabling patients to maintain an active lifestyle.
